Abstract :
This paper presents the harmonic cancellation of a 3rd order Butterworth response parallel-coupled bandpass filter by introducing periodical grooves. The cancellation was obtained by aligning the transmission zero of the tight coupling (TCg) coupler with the harmonic of the weak coupling (WCg) coupler. The alignment of transmission zero and harmonic was carried out by introducing square grooves periodically at the TCg and WGc couplers. Various numbers of grooves were introduced at the TCg and WCg couplers. By varying the number of grooves at the TCg coupler, the first transmission zero was obtained. Then similar method was used to align the harmonics of the WCg coupler with transmission zero of the TCg coupler. When three stage bandpass filter design with transmission zero of the TCg coupler is aligned with the harmonic of the WCg coupler, the overall the performance of filter improved in terms of suppression of the harmonics and cutoff frequencies.
